J Hose Leak

Post by Esnoyer »

I have had an ongoing problem with my Check Engine light coming on from time to time,I had a new volvo gas cap installed
after avolvo dealers computer showed a valcum leak.eack time the light comes on it still showes a valcum leak...
Dealer did a smoke test and NOW says its the J hose and in order to replace it the exaust system must be lowered,a pan
as well ,all of this to replace a $0.25 hose ,Oh yes plus hose clamps..THEY only want $329.00.. Great VOLVO design..
Has anyone replaced this hose ,any ideas??

Post by jbrown122 »

Are you sure the 01 doesn't use a J-hose? Ipd sells one for the 01....
Anyways, here is a link to a video explaining where the J hose is on an older model, ( but I believe it's still in the same place. It helps to remove the fuel filter, you will have more access to the hose. A local dealer wanted to charge me $380 for this job. Got it from ipd for $20...
